BAPE and adidas are teaming up once again for a striking football collection that perfectly blends performance and streetwear. The collaboration brings BAPE’s iconic ABC CAMO print to adidas classics such as the Predator, the F50, and the adidas Originals Samba.

Football vs. streetwear

Football is hot. It has been for a while, but in 2025 the sport’s influence reaches deeper than ever into fashion. The collaboration with Japanese streetwear label BAPE is proof of that once again. The collab brings BAPE’s bold, colourful designs to classics that have dominated the pitch for decades.
The Predator Elite is one of them. The boot drops in BAPE’s green ABC CAMO with gold accents and a shark graphic, a detail you might recognise from the brand’s iconic hoodies, placed on the tongue flap. The F50 Elite arrives in a bold ‘Blue Pink’ colorway, featuring a striking camo gradient and an all-over star print across the upper.

For those who spend less time on the pitch, there’s the adidas Originals Samba. This lifestyle classic comes in premium leather and features a subtle BAPE Skull Sta motif on the T-toe. The Samba will be available in two colorways: ‘White’ and ‘Black’.
The apparel line-up includes ABC CAMO jerseys, shorts and tights, complemented by a BABY MILO® football tee. Accessories feature an ABC CAMO duffle and a BABY MILO® shoulder bag, with the latter set to release later in September.
Release
The adidas x BAPE collection will be available in limited quantities starting 6 September 2025 via CONFIRMED, adidas.com, selected retailers, BAPE.com, and BAPE STORE locations worldwide.
